Interesting. I have limited experience, but have never seen a small trailer set up with separate 3" drains for the gray and black systems. Having 2 drains, one on either side of your axles/tires is going to complicate the dumping process. As you note, you will need to set up two drain hoses with a Y connection for hookups. This always poses problems as you try to "walk the drain hoses dry". Your dump station time will increase. And you lose the ability to fully "flush" your black drain system with your gray tank water. I would consider this system a minus in a small trailer. They probably did this under the guise of "weight saving"...but how heavy is 10' of 3" plastic pipe?
